IBM Impact: WebLayers and Ford Address Software Glitches

  
  
  
  
  

It's been an interesting year since the last IBM IMPACT conference.  In a lot of ways, this conference is like Old Home Week for me having been the CEO of Lotus and having stayed on for several years after the IBM acquisition. So along with reconnecting with some of the smartest folks in the industry, IMPACT also gives me a chance to learn about what's on the horizon because IBM is always years ahead of the rest of the industry.

From a WebLayers perspective, we're excited about a lot of things happening at IMPACT. Here's a quick rundown.
